SharpLink Gaming, Inc. (SBET), a pioneering online performance marketing company specializing in the sports betting and iGaming sectors, is making significant strides in the cryptocurrency landscape. Based in Minneapolis, SharpLink harnesses its AI-driven C4 platform to provide personalized, data-centric marketing strategies that boost customer acquisition and retention for sports betting and casino operators. Through strategic acquisitions and partnerships, the company has established itself as a frontrunner in a rapidly evolving sports betting ecosystem.

On July 4, 2025, SharpLink announced via X that it has become the first publicly traded company to adopt ETH as its primary treasury reserve asset. This initiative is backed by a comprehensive treasury strategy aimed at accumulating ETH, staking it, and increasing ETH-per-share to enhance long-term shareholder value.

The company has made it clear that its intentions extend beyond merely holding ETH. It plans to actively utilize the asset through native staking, restaking, and various Ethereum-based yield-generating strategies. SharpLink highlighted several benefits of using ETH as a corporate reserve asset: its productivity from staking rewards, composability across decentralized finance protocols, scarcity, security, and alignment with the future internet’s infrastructure. This strategic pivot represents a significant redefinition of traditional treasury management, merging principles of decentralized finance with corporate finance.

The shift began with a $425 million private placement announcement on May 27, which was led by Consensys and several other prominent investors in the crypto sector. This funding is designated for acquiring ETH as SharpLink’s primary treasury asset. Notably, Joseph Lubin, co-founder of Ethereum and founder of Consensys, joined SharpLink’s Board of Directors as Chairman, solidifying the company’s dedication to blockchain innovation.

Since unveiling its ETH treasury strategy on June 2, SharpLink has aggressively bolstered its Ethereum holdings. Between May 30 and June 12, 2025, the company secured approximately 176,271 ETH for roughly $463 million, at an average price of $2,626 per ETH. Further, between June 16 and June 20, an additional 12,207 ETH were acquired for about $30.7 million, partially funded by $27.7 million generated through At-The-Market (ATM) equity sales.

As of June 24, SharpLink’s ETH reserves had reached 188,478 ETH, with all holdings deployed in staking solutions generating staking rewards. By July 1, this treasury had expanded further to 198,478 ETH, yielding over 220 ETH in staking rewards since the inception of the strategy.

Joseph Lubin remarked that embedding Ethereum at the core of SharpLink’s capital strategy signifies technological advancement and institutional trust, positioning the company as a leader in the evolution of digital commerce. Meanwhile, CEO Rob Phythian noted that SharpLink’s upcoming Nasdaq closing bell ceremony on July 7, 2025, would symbolize this new phase, demonstrating how digital assets can harmonize with public market discipline and corporate governance.

SharpLink’s Ethereum treasury strategy places the company at the intersection of sports betting, blockchain technology, and decentralized finance. This unique positioning offers investors regulated and transparent exposure to the growth potential of Ethereum while advancing SharpLink’s mission to innovate within the multi-billion-dollar iGaming industry.
